KATY (1080 KRLD) - A five-foot-long gator slithered out from a bayou and decided to sun itself near some train tracks in Katy, Texas.

Someone saw it and became concerned. They called police and Patrol Captain Bryon Woitek with Katy police says, "We contacted our Humane Officer who came out and got the alligator. The alligator was released  to the Texas Parks and Wildlife Game Warden."

The alligator was put in a temporary cage and released it back to its home in the bayou.

Woitek says, "If you see an alligator or another creature where it's not supposed to be, don't approach them. Instead, contact us and let us handle it."
